This cutting-edge information will enhance the knowledge, skills, and performance of providers involved in physical, social, and behavioral health aspects of care in adolescents and young adults.

The increased knowledge and skills will help attendees better advocate for youth in all domains of health and well-being.

Objectives:

  • Recognize structural vulnerabilities that influence the health and well-being of Gender Diverse Youth and discuss ways to strengthen the potential for resiliency to thrive
  • Consider the impact of THC on the developing brain and devise talking points to educate youth
    Summarize the consequences of fentanyl and other synthetic opioid use and strategize means to decrease its use among adolescents
  • Describe the new over-the-counter birth control pill, and review the evidence-based guidelines for the recommended length of use for the implant and IUD’s
  • Identify the signs of disordered eating and develop approaches to prevent it from becoming an eating disorder
